Connecticut 2023 Regular Session

Connecticut House Bill HB05558

Introduced
1/18/23  

Caption

An Act Requiring Reimbursement Of The Cost To Transport Special Education Students Outside Of District.

Impact

If enacted, HB 05558 would significantly alleviate the fiscal pressure on local educational authorities by transferring some of the financial responsibilities to the state. By ensuring that municipalities are reimbursed for transporting special education students, the bill could encourage school districts to provide greater access to specialized programs that are not available within their jurisdiction. This could enhance educational opportunities for students with disabilities and ensure compliance with federal mandates regarding special education.

Summary

House Bill 05558 aims to address the financial burden municipalities face when providing transportation for special education students who must travel outside their home districts to access appropriate educational services. The bill proposes a change to Title 10 of the general statutes to require the state to reimburse these municipalities for the incurred transportation costs. This measure is intended to support local governments in fulfilling their educational obligations without incurring excessive expenses.
